Output 89b7bda6799efbddcad20779fc7569aa7caee96bb62b8533146fe7451df37b6d:4

value
86000
script pubkey
OP_0 OP_PUSHBYTES_32 e1efb070bc824045dd1499d73dcf2f36a57a49a51efe19dbcf5e96155b16ac50
address
bc1qu8hmqu9usfqythg5n8tnmne0x6jh5jd9rmlpnk70t6tp2kck43gqulr3xr
transaction
89b7bda6799efbddcad20779fc7569aa7caee96bb62b8533146fe7451df37b6d
spent
true